CMHK to terminate 3G services on 30 June

3G users accounted for only 0.25% of its mobile subscription base.

China Mobile Hong Kong Company Limited (CMHK) will terminate its 3G services on 30 June 2025, focusing resources on promoting 5G and advanced network technologies.

This comes as the number of customers using 3G services declined, accounting for only 0.25% of its mobile subscription base.

To ensure a smooth transition, CMHK advises customers to upgrade their 3G mobile phones, devices, or SIM cards.
